FireFighter™ Sensor (2GIG-FF1E-345)
Add professional fire and CO alerting to homes that already have code-required smoke/CO alarms. The 2GIG-FF1E-345 is an encrypted audio “listening” sensor that mounts near an existing UL-listed smoke or CO detector and recognizes the alarm tones (Temporal-3 for smoke, Temporal-4 for CO). When it hears a valid pattern, it sends a wireless life-safety signal to your 2GIG panel and Alarm.com.

Key Features
Listens for UL tones: Recognizes Temporal-3 (smoke) and Temporal-4 (CO) patterns by default; optional generic mode is available for certain legacy non-temporal alarms.
Dual reporting (Smoke + CO): Enroll two zones from one unit—Smoke uses the printed serial; CO uses serial + 1—so events display separately in your panel/app.
Encrypted communication: eSeries AES-class security to the panel over 345 MHz.
Fast, simple install: Mount within 6″ of the detector; bracket, screws, and tape included.
Works with what you have: Does not change your existing UL alarms or their approvals.
Product Specifications (At-a-Glance)
Model: 2GIG-FF1E-345 (eSeries, encrypted). Non-encrypted counterpart: 2GIG-FF1-345.
What it does: Audio detector for UL smoke/CO alarms; sends Alarm / Supervisory / Low-Battery to the panel.
Mounting distance: ≤ 6 inches from the smoke/CO detector’s sounder openings.
Radio: 345.00 MHz (crystal-controlled); Equipment Code 2069 (2GIG). Supervisory interval ~64 min.
Power: 1× CR123A 3 V lithium (1550 mAh); typical life ~3 years. Max current draw 23 mA (tx).
Environment: 32–120 °F (0–49 °C); 5–95% RH, non-condensing. ABS, white. Listings: FCC/IC/ETL.
Compatibility Notes
Panels: FF1E-345 requires a 2GIG eSeries panel (GC2e/GC3e/EDGE). Use FF1-345 on non-eSeries 2GIG/Honeywell-345 systems. We confirm during site survey.
Interconnected vs. stand-alone alarms: With interconnected wired smokes, one FireFighter can cover the network; with non-interconnected units, install one per alarm.
Important: FireFighter does not directly detect smoke, heat, fire, or CO—your existing UL alarms remain the primary detectors.

Frequently Asked Questions
How does it “hear” both smoke and CO?
By default it recognizes Temporal-3 (smoke) and Temporal-4 (CO) tones. We enroll two zones (Smoke & CO) so the panel and app show them separately.
Where exactly do you mount it?
Right next to the alarm—within 6 inches—and oriented so the FireFighter’s microphone holes face the alarm’s sounder openings.
Can it work with older, non-temporal alarms?
Yes—there’s a generic listening mode for certain legacy alarms. We only use it when needed and follow the manual’s placement cautions.
Will one unit cover my whole house?
If your wired smokes are interconnected (one-go-all-go), a single FireFighter can usually monitor the whole network. Otherwise, use one per stand-alone alarm.
What maintenance is required?
We recommend weekly tests using the alarm’s test button (especially during the first hour after power-up when FireFighter is in test mode) and replacing the CR123A when the panel reports low battery.
